Did Tom Cruise Do the Dubai Stunt?

Tom Cruise is known for his daring stunts in his action-packed films, and one of the most memorable ones took place in Dubai. In the movie Mission: Impossible – Ghost Protocol, Cruise’s character, Ethan Hunt, scaled the towering Burj Khalifa, the world’s tallest building at that time. But did Tom Cruise actually perform this death-defying stunt himself?

The Burj Khalifa Stunt

The Burj Khalifa stunt scene in Mission: Impossible – Ghost Protocol is undoubtedly one of the highlights of the film. Ethan Hunt, played by Tom Cruise, must climb the exterior of this architectural marvel without any safety equipment. The scene showcases breathtaking shots of Cruise scaling the massive structure with no visible CGI or green screen effects.

Many moviegoers were left wondering if it was really Tom Cruise who performed this incredible feat.

Tom Cruise’s Dedication to Authenticity

Tom Cruise is renowned for his commitment to performing his own stunts whenever possible. Throughout his career, he has pushed boundaries and taken extraordinary risks to deliver thrilling and authentic action sequences to audiences.

In interviews, both Cruise and director Brad Bird confirmed that he indeed performed the Burj Khalifa stunt himself. The actor underwent intense training, including scaling smaller buildings and extensive safety preparations before attempting this audacious feat.
